Saturn Rise Over Mimas

Watercolor of Saturn rising over Mimas as it would look from Hershel’s Crater, as depicted in chapter 2 of The Return of the Osprey. Mimas is one of the 53 named moons of Saturn. It was discovered in 1789 by William Herschel. It is named after Mimas, a son of Gaia in Greek mythology. It serves as an emergency landing site for the Osprey after her misadventure with "leading edge" technology.
